What are Chicago servers?

Chicago servers are food and beverage service professionals who work in restaurants, bars, hotels, or event venues in the Chicago area. Their main responsibilities include taking orders, serving food and drinks, providing customer service, and ensuring guests have a positive dining experience. Chicago servers may also help with setting tables, handling payments, and keeping the dining area clean. The job often requires strong communication sk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work in a fast-paced environment. Many Chicago servers rely on tips as a significant part of their income.

How do servers in Chicago restaurants typically handle high-volume shifts and maintain excellent customer service?

Servers in Chicago often work in busy environments, especially during peak hours or special events. To manage high-volume shifts, they rely on strong organizational skills, teamwork, and a deep knowledge of the menu. Communication with kitchen staff and fellow servers is crucial to ensure timely and accurate orders. Maintaining a positive attitude and multitasking efficiently helps servers provide excellent customer service even when the restaurant is crowded.

Job description

Systems Administrator, Secret Security Clearance Required, Arlington, VA
The Systems Administrator will perform a wide variety of system administration tasks for the Content Server solution. This could include installation, configuration, upgrades, and operational support.
Responsibilities:
- For Content Server and associated modules: Install new software release, do system upgrade, evaluate and install patches and resolve software related problems.
- Monitor system to ensure solution is operating as expected and make adjustments as needed to ensure optimal performance.
- Analyze and resolve problems associated with server hardware, operating systems, applications software.
- Provide second level customer system support for customer software/system applications.
- Provide guidance from a design and architecture perspective related to functional and system requirements.
Qualifications:
- Minimum of an Associate's Degree required.
- Secret Level Clearance required.
- Requires 4 or more years in progressively responsible positions in IT consulting projects.
- Previous experience with the Open Text product stack preferred.
- Content Management experience is a plus.
- Experience with Application Administration, SharePoint, Documentum, FileNet, Exchange Administration and Servers is a plus.
- Security+ Certification preferred.
- Strong client relationship skills. Must be able to interface internally and externally with client project team.
- Strong verbal and written communication skills needed, along with the ability to work independently with minimal supervision.
Benefits include medical insurance, retirement plan, PTO, etc. Salary: 80K+ DOE.
